From ec051fb67efab46eb3f3aba465f90dd067cc12b7 Mon Sep 17 00:00:00 2001 From: HugoRCD Date: Mon, 2 Dec 2024 12:41:39 +0100 Subject: [PATCH] enhance hero --- apps/base/app.config.ts | 1 + apps/base/assets/css/base.css | 21 +++++++++++++++++++ apps/base/components/CrossedDiv.vue | 14 +++++++++++-- apps/base/components/Logo.vue | 2 +- apps/lp/app/components/landing/Hero.vue | 9 +++++--- apps/lp/app/components/layout/Navbar.vue | 1 + apps/shelve/app/assets/icons/nucleo/users.svg | 13 ++++++++++++ apps/shelve/app/assets/texture.svg | 12 +++++++++++ apps/shelve/app/components/Callout.vue | 19 +++++++++++++++++ apps/shelve/app/components/team/Manager.vue | 2 +- 10 files changed, 87 insertions(+), 7 deletions(-) create mode 100644 apps/shelve/app/assets/icons/nucleo/users.svg create mode 100644 apps/shelve/app/assets/texture.svg create mode 100644 apps/shelve/app/components/Callout.vue diff --git a/apps/base/app.config.ts b/apps/base/app.config.ts index 0a6c7126..7221e9cc 100644 --- a/apps/base/app.config.ts +++ b/apps/base/app.config.ts @@ -1,6 +1,7 @@ export default defineAppConfig({ ui: { colors: { + primary: 'blue', neutral: 'neutral', }, button: { diff --git a/apps/base/assets/css/base.css b/apps/base/assets/css/base.css index f21cfa12..b1319c10 100644 --- a/apps/base/assets/css/base.css +++ b/apps/base/assets/css/base.css @@ -30,3 +30,24 @@ html, body, #__nuxt, #__layout { .main-gradient { @apply font-geist-mono bg-gradient-to-r from-neutral-50 to-neutral-600 to-50% bg-clip-text text-transparent; } + +.bg-stripes { + @apply w-full [background-size:4px_4px] opacity-75; + @apply dark:[background-image:linear-gradient(-45deg,var(--color-neutral-700)_12.50%,transparent_12.50%,transparent_50%,var(--color-neutral-700)_50%,var(--color-neutral-700)_62.50%,transparent_62.50%,transparent_100%)]; + @apply not-dark:[background-image:linear-gradient(-45deg,var(--color-neutral-200)_12.50%,transparent_12.50%,transparent_50%,var(--color-neutral-200)_50%,var(--color-neutral-200)_62.50%,transparent_62.50%,transparent_100%)]; +} + +.bg-dotted { + background-image: + radial-gradient(transparent, Canvas), + radial-gradient( + color-mix(in oklch, Canvastext 33%, Canvas) 0.8px, + transparent 1.3px + ); + background-size: + 200px 200px, + 40px 40px; + background-repeat: + round, + space; +} diff --git a/apps/base/components/CrossedDiv.vue b/apps/base/components/CrossedDiv.vue index 2fed409d..60468f99 100644 --- a/apps/base/components/CrossedDiv.vue +++ b/apps/base/components/CrossedDiv.vue @@ -23,7 +23,6 @@ defineProps<{ diff --git a/apps/shelve/app/components/team/Manager.vue b/apps/shelve/app/components/team/Manager.vue index e781f330..289c6e99 100644 --- a/apps/shelve/app/components/team/Manager.vue +++ b/apps/shelve/app/components/team/Manager.vue @@ -49,7 +49,7 @@ const groups = computed(() => [ {{ currentTeam.name }} - +